[Text and photos by Mayank Austen Soofi] Some places are like a laidback piece of music that initially leaves you indifferent but soon enough, even before you realize it, you are humming its tunes in the bathroom. The garden in Gurgaon’s Sheetla Mata Mandir has that character. It makes no desperate attempt to make a good first impression. Instead, the place wins you slowly. All you have to do is to arrive in the park alone, settle down on a bench, and wait patiently for it to take over your senses. This afternoon the muddy-brown ground is strewn with peepal leaves.
